Electrical Hazards Training Specialist / Program Coordinator Summary:
The Electrical Hazards Training Specialist / Program Coordinator is responsible for the administration, scheduling, maintenance, coordination of transportation and logistics, training delivery, and continuous improvement of Townsend's Electrical Hazards Training (EHT) Trailer Program. This position ensures employees receive consistent, engaging, and technically accurate electrical hazards training through classroom instruction and live demonstrations while maintaining the highest standards of operational safety, equipment readiness, and regulatory compliance.
The Electrical Hazards Training Specialist/ Program Coordinator serves as the company's subject matter expert for the EHT Trailer Program and works closely with Operations, Health & Safety, Fleet, Facilities, and regional
leadership to maximize the effectiveness and availability of this critical training resource.

Equipment and PPE Management
- Inspect, maintain, and replace electrical protective equipment.
- Coordinate electrical testing and certification of insulating rubber goods.
- Maintain inspection, testing, and replacement records.
- Ensure all demonstration equipment remains compliant with company requirements.
- Manage inventory of gloves, sleeves, overshoes, hot sticks, demonstration materials, and consumable supplies.
Safety Leadership
- Ensure every demonstration is conducted safely and professionally.
- Conduct pre-demonstration job briefings.
- Verify all protective systems are functioning before energizing equipment.
- Suspend demonstrations whenever unsafe conditions exist.
- Investigate equipment deficiencies and coordinate corrective actions.
- Maintain current knowledge of OSHA regulations, ANSI Z133, industry best practices, and company standards related to electrical hazards.
